Glenville, NC (ZIP 28736) has a moderate disaster history with 39 recorded events. These include 20 hailstorms, 14 floods, and 2 extreme cold events. Total documented property damage amounts to $15M.
With 20 recorded incidents (51% of all events), hailstorms are the leading natural hazard for this ZIP code. The most recent recorded hailstorm occurred on May 8, 2025.
There have been 14 recorded floods in this area, representing 36% of all disaster events. Of these, 11 (79%) were rated at severity level 4 or 5 — the most intense on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for flood-related events here is 5/5 (extreme). Flood-related events have caused a combined $11M in documented property damage. The most recent recorded flood occurred on Sep 27, 2024.
Glenville has experienced 2 extreme cold events on record. Of these, 2 (100%) were rated at severity level 4 or 5 — the most intense on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for cold-related events here is 4/5 (severe). Cold-related events have caused a combined $1M in documented property damage. The most recent recorded extreme cold event occurred on Apr 8, 2007.
Glenville has experienced 1 blizzard on record. One event reached severity level 4 or 5 on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for winter storm events here is 5/5 (extreme). Winter storm events have caused a combined $3M in documented property damage. The most recent recorded blizzard occurred on Dec 4, 2002.
Glenville has experienced 1 tornado on record. The most recent recorded tornado occurred on May 8, 2024.
Glenville has experienced 1 severe wind event on record. The most recent recorded severe wind event occurred on Apr 15, 2007.
The most significant disaster event on record for Glenville was Flash Flood on Sep 27, 2024, which caused $10M in property damage. Another major event was Ice Storm (Dec 4, 2002), causing $3M in damages.
